About the Item

Crafted in the early 20th century, this fireplace in oak and blue stoneware is a creation by the Parisian firm Gentil & Bourdet, founded in 1904. The stoneware panels framing the hearth feature prominent Egyptian scarabs in high relief, interwoven with stylized foliage. The tapering overmantel, reminiscent of a pyramid, is faced with plain blue stoneware tiles. At the center of the frieze, a floral medallion is flanked by a knotted rope motif on each side, reinforcing the piece’s symbolic and exotic character. This fireplace exemplifies the innovative design language of Gentil & Bourdet, whose work bridged the Art Nouveau and Art Deco movements. Renowned for their use of glazed stoneware in architectural ornamentation, the firm’s pieces were widely adopted in buildings across France. This model was exhibited in the furniture section of the 1904 Salon de l’Art Décoratif, organized by the Société des Artistes Français. Critic Gustave Soulier noted the piece in the Revue mensuelle d’Art contemporain, writing: “Messrs. Gentil and Bourdet made excellent use of stoneware in the two fireplaces they presented” (p. 14).

Art Nouveau paneling in Walnut with a wood Fireplace with Ceramic
Located in SAINT-OUEN-SUR-SEINE, FR
This exceptional Art Nouveau style pine and burr paneled room is beautifully carved and decorated with blue-green ceramics. Panels with elegant curved and sober lines are covering the bottom of the walls and harmonize the room to its center; a fireplace and its monumental over mantel mirror carved in walnut wood. The mirror is framed by a dynamic and undulating foliage, a pattern we can also find inside the fireplace in green enameled ceramic, which is highlighting the wood texture. The large overmantel mirror sumptuously raises the space of the chimney, structured with two consoles allowing to place lamps.
